David Boreanaz – Net Worth, Age, Wife, and TV Shows

Harry Clarke Howard • 2026-07-17 • Reviewed by Maya Thompson

David Boreanaz has been a fixture on American television for over two decades, moving from cult vampire drama to primetime procedural and then to military action series. Few actors have successfully anchored three long-running network shows. As of 2026, Boreanaz is taking on another major role, demonstrating that his career shows no signs of slowing down.

Born in Buffalo, New York, and raised in Pennsylvania, Boreanaz initially pursued a career in front of the camera after studying film at Ithaca College. His breakthrough came in 1997, when he was cast as a brooding vampire with a soul. From there, he built a reputation as a reliable leading man capable of carrying a series for many seasons.

What is David Boreanaz Net Worth and How Successful is He?

Public net worth figures for celebrities are often estimates from third-party sites. No official, verified net worth figure for David Boreanaz has been published by himself or a financial representative. However, his long tenure in high-profile series provides a reliable basis for estimating significant earnings. Bones ran for 12 seasons, and SEAL Team ran for 7 seasons. For his lead role on SEAL Team, reports suggested he earned up to $250,000 per episode. His directing work on the same series likely added to his income.

Syndication rights from Bones and Angel continue to generate residuals, which is a common source of long-term wealth for actors in successful network shows. Real estate investments, including properties in Los Angeles, also contribute. Most industry estimates place his net worth between $25 million and $30 million as of 2025.

Uncertainty Note

Exact net worth figures are speculative. The provided range of $25–30 million is based on typical industry salary reports and real estate transactions reported by outlets such as Celebrity Net Worth and Forbes. There is no official confirmation from Boreanaz or his financial team.

Who is David Boreanaz Married To? (Personal Life)

Wife: Jaime Bergman

David Boreanaz has been married to actress and model Jaime Bergman since November 24, 2001. Bergman is known for her work as a model and for acting roles in shows such as Son of the Beach. The couple has two children together: a son, Jaden Rayne, born in 2002, and a daughter, Bella.

Previous Marriage

Before marrying Bergman, Boreanaz was married to Ingrid Quinn. They were married in June 1997 and divorced in October 1999. This first marriage was brief and occurred before his rise to major fame.

Children and Family Life

Boreanaz and Bergman have maintained a relatively private family life. His son, Jaden Rayne, is occasionally seen at public events, but the family generally avoids the Hollywood spotlight. The couple has been together for over two decades, a notable achievement in the entertainment industry.

What Movies and TV Shows is David Boreanaz Famous For?

Angel (Buffy the Vampire Slayer / Angel)

His breakout role was as Angel, a vampire cursed with a soul, in Buffy the Vampire Slayer. The character was so popular that it spawned a spin-off series, Angel, which ran for five seasons from 1999 to 2004. This role cemented Boreanaz as a leading man in genre television.

Seeley Booth (Bones)

In 2005, Boreanaz transitioned to primetime procedural drama with Bones. He played FBI Special Agent Seeley Booth opposite Emily Deschanel’s Dr. Temperance Brennan. The show was a major ratings success for Fox, running for 12 seasons until 2017. This role broadened his audience far beyond the genre fanbase.

Jason Hayes (SEAL Team)

From 2017 to 2024, Boreanaz starred as Master Chief Jason Hayes in the military drama SEAL Team. He also directed multiple episodes of the series, adding director and producer credits to his resume. The show aired on CBS before moving to Paramount+ for its later seasons, demonstrating his adaptability to the streaming era.

Early Career

His first credited television role was a guest spot on Married… with Children in 1993, where he played Frank, the boyfriend of Christina Applegate’s character, Kelly Bundy. This early appearance connects him to one of the most famous sitcoms of the 1990s.

Film Work

While primarily a television actor, Boreanaz has appeared in films such as Suffering Man’s Charity (2007), a black comedy co-starring Anne Heche. His filmography is relatively small compared to his extensive television work.

What is the Connection Between David Boreanaz and Christina Applegate?

The primary connection between David Boreanaz and Christina Applegate is professional. Boreanaz made his acting debut in 1993 on an episode of Married… with Children, where Applegate was a main cast member. He played Frank, the boyfriend of Applegate’s character Kelly Bundy.

Later, in 1999, Boreanaz guest-starred on the sitcom Jesse, which was created by and starred Applegate. This was another straightforward co-star appearance. There is no documented romantic relationship between the two actors. Persistent online speculation appears to stem from their on-screen chemistry in the Married… with Children episode, but no verified sources support any deeper connection.

Why Has David Boreanaz Remained Relevant for Decades?

Boreanaz’s longevity in television is notable. He successfully transitioned from a WB vampire drama to a primetime procedural on Fox, and then to a military drama that moved to streaming. This kind of cross-platform success is rare. He has built a loyal fanbase that spans genre television, crime procedural, and action drama.

His work as a director and producer, particularly on SEAL Team, has also expanded his role in the industry, allowing him to have creative influence beyond acting. This combination of leading man charisma, adaptability, and behind-the-camera ambition has kept him consistently employed for over 25 years.
